Cary, NC (PRWEB) August 15, 2004 --Crescent State Bank, the wholly owned subsidiary of Crescent Financial Corporation, (Nasdaq SmallCap CRFN) has announced that Linda Lee, Vice President and Mortgage Banking Manager, has been named to the Mortgage Bankers Association of the Carolinas, Inc. (MBAC) Education Committee, committed to assessing the educational needs of the Association members. In this position, Lee will serve for one year working closely with other committees to meet the educational needs of the members, as well as scheduling and organizing at least two seminars each year.
The Mortgage Bankers Association of the Carolinas, Inc. (MBAC) offers services such as legislative representation, education and training, networking, and informational resources to those participating in the mortgage lending industry within North and South Carolina. Members include residential and commercial mortgage bankers, mortgage brokers, wholesale lenders, savings and loan associations, commercial banks, credit unions, government agencies, non-profit organizations, and companies that provide affiliated services to mortgage bankers.
Crescent State Bank is a wholly owned subsidiary of Crescent Financial Corporation. The Bank was opened in December 1998 to serve the financial needs of the communities it serves. The bank has total assets of approximately $309 million and deposits of approximately $263 million as of June 30, 2004, with seven full service banking offices in the communities of Cary (2), Apex, Clayton, Holly Springs, Southern Pines, and Pinehurst, North Carolina. The bank will shortly open a full service branch in Sanford to replace its loan production office.
